How do CFM benchmarks prevent mold development in residential water scenarios?

CFM (cubic feet per minute) measures how much air an air mover circulates through a space. Industry baseline data shows that 1,000 square feet of affected space needs a minimum of 5,000 to 6,000 CFM of continuous air movement to maintain drying velocity across wet materials. When CFM falls below these documented benchmarks, airflow stagnates in corners and under baseboards—precisely where mold establishes fastest. How undersized equipment creates the humidity threshold that activates mold germination?

Mold germinates when relative humidity exceeds 60% for extended periods. Oversized dehumidifier capacity pulls humidity down aggressively; undersized capacity allows it to hover in the danger zone. The data shows that equipment capacity below 1 pint per 100 square feet per 24 hours correlates directly with relative humidity remaining above 60% after day one. When equipment meets or exceeds 1.5 pints per 100 square feet per 24 hours, humidity drops below 55% and holds there, shutting down fungal colonization before it starts. What does monitored moisture extraction data reveal about preventing mold establishment?

Professional restoration tracking includes hourly or twice-daily moisture readings using calibrated meters that measure both surface and sub-surface saturation. When extraction equipment operates at spec, you see documented decline: 85% moisture content drops to 75% by hour 12, 65% by hour 24, 55% by hour 48. If readings plateau or decline too slowly, it signals undersized equipment before mold has any opportunity to colonize. We use psychrometric charts—the industry standard tool—to plot humidity and temperature against drying curve benchmarks, confirming in real-time that our equipment selections are preventing the conditions mold needs.
